beach chick Posted December 15, 2008 Share Posted December 15, 2008 Meringue has been mostly off laying for a few weeks. then we had one good one, next day a softie and then nothing for a couple of days. today, she has laid what I think is a normal egg INSIDE a softie skin!! I managed to peel the biggest bit of outer 'shell' off, leaving a pale patch behind which seems normal (tho not her normal deep brown colour). the rest of the 'skin' is very rough and wrinkled - most odd. the day before yesterday we had gales, and one of the old eglu runs with plastic cover but minus the eglu itself blew over - they all seemed quite stressed so I wonder if this might have caused it? she's fine in herself, so I'm not worried, just a little amazed at what you see from chicken-keeping! Hannah and peeps Posted December 16, 2008 Share Posted December 16, 2008 One of my chickens had a phase of laying eggs that had no shell but were in a like a bag of egg skin, she would even lay a couple connected together like sausages. I started saving my other chickens good egg shells and baking them and crushing them up (so that they look nothing like eggs) and putting them in the food. Now she never lays any funny eggs and her eggs have good strong shells.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
